Slate shingle replacement services involve removing damaged or aging slate shingles and installing new ones to restore the roof’s integrity and appearance. This process requires careful inspection to identify shingles that are cracked, broken, or deteriorating due to weather exposure or age. Skilled contractors handle the removal of compromised shingles, ensure proper disposal, and securely install new slate pieces that match the existing roof. This service helps maintain the roof’s durability and aesthetic appeal, preventing further damage that could lead to leaks or structural issues.

The overview below groups typical Slate Shingle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Elgin,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or slate shingle repairs in Elgin range from $250 to $600, covering small sections or individual shingles.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and access.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um for more extensive or complex repairs.
Partial Replacement - Replacing a section of slate shingles usually costs between $1,500 and $3,500. Local contractors often see many projects in this range, especially when addressing localized damage or deteriorated areas. Larger, more involved partial replacements can push costs higher, especially on older roofs.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ete slate shingle roof replacements in Elgin typically range from $10,000 to $20,000, depending on roof size and complexity. Many full replacements fall into this range, while larger or more intricate projects may exceed $20,000. The final cost varies based on material quality and roof design.
Complex or Custom Projects - Highly detailed or custom slate roofing projects can cost $25,000 or more. These are less common and generally involve intricate designs, unusual roof shapes, or extensive structural work. Most local service providers handle projects within the typical cost ranges, with only the most complex exceeding this tier.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s that slate shingles need replacement? Visible damage such as cracked, broken, or missing shingles can indicate the need for replacement. Additionally, leaks or water stains inside the building may suggest underlying issues with the slate roof.
Can slate shingle replacement improve my roof's durability? Yes, replacing damaged or old slate shingles with new ones can enhance the roof’s strength and longevity, helping to protect the structure from weather-related damage.
Are there different types of slate shingles used in replacements? There are various styles and grades of slate shingles available, allowing for options that match the existing roof or provide a new aesthetic, depending on the project requirements.
What should I consider when choosing a contractor for slate shingle replacement? It's important to select a service provider with experience in slate roofing, good local reputation, and a history of quality work to ensure the replacement is properly handled.
Is it possible to replace only damaged slate shingles instead of the entire roof? Yes, in many cases, individual damaged shingles can be replaced without needing a full roof overhaul, provided the rest of the roof is in good condition.
